The CORTEX Best Source Selector (BSS) is the ultimate choice for real-time telemetry source selection. It’s the go-to tool for pinpointing the best Telemetry source among multiple antennas tracking the same airframe across various channels.
The Best Source Selector streamlines the selection process by automatically choosing the top Telemetry stream, even from up to 16 sources or more, using a combination of signal quality metrics and other criteria. With its extensive capabilities in aligning paths and compensating for delays, the CORTEX Best Source Selector ensures optimal source selection, no matter where the antennas are located or what kind of range infrastructure you’re working with.

Absolute EMC
Absolute EMC LLC is a premier North American provider of electromagnetic compatibility (EMC) expertise and test equipment. They deliver end to end consulting—covering IEC, MIL STD, CISPR, and automotive standards—hands on training for all EMC and RF test instruments, and turnkey test system design and integration. Leveraging decades of experience with every major manufacturer and the latest technologies, they also offer strategic guidance on equipment selection, market trends, and procurement to help you maximize the performance and ROI of your EMC investments.
